Overview
Modern metro stations require fast, reliable, and secure gate control systems to ensure smooth passenger flow, reduce congestion, and maintain security. The MS-C906 (I3-1315URE) was selected as the core computing platform for its compact form factor, robust processing power, and advanced connectivity options. The system needed to handle real-time passenger authentication, interface with central control systems, and withstand the challenging operational conditions of metro stations.
System Requirements
- 1. Real-Time Passenger Processing:
- Support for contactless smart card validation and QR code scanning.
- Fast processing to minimize delays during peak hours.
- 2. Connectivity with Central Systems:
- Integration with the metro's central ticketing and monitoring systems.
- Utilization of multiple networks to connect to the metro's network, with one LAN being offline while the other takes over, ensuring redundancy.
- 3. Compact and Durable Design:
- Fit within the compact space of automated gate enclosures.
- Operate reliably in high-traffic environments with frequent power fluctuations.
- Support for wide temperature (-20~70°C) ranges to ensure functionality in diverse conditions.
- 4. Enhanced Security:
- Secure data handling for passenger ticket validation and system diagnostics.
Solution: MS-C906 for Gate Control Systems
The MS-C906 (I3-1315URE) met these requirements and enhanced the metro station’s gate control infrastructure::
- 1. Real-Time Processing:
- Powered by an Intel® Core™ i3-1315URE, the MS-C906 provided ample computing power to process smart card data and QR codes in real time.
- Efficient multi-threading enabled smooth operation even during high-traffic hours.
- 2. Versatile Connectivity:
- Multiple COM Ports: Allowed direct communication with ticket scanners, card readers, and gate actuators.
- LAN Ports (2.5 GbE): Enabled seamless integration with the central ticketing server for real-time data synchronization and redundancy.
- USB Ports: Supported peripherals such as barcode scanners and maintenance devices.
- 3. Compact and Rugged Design:
- The SBC 3.5” form factor made it suitable for compact gate enclosures, while the industrial-grade build ensured durability in high-vibration environments.
- CPU i3-1315URE: Supports wide temperature ranges, making it a key feature for customers choosing this SKU, with an operating temperature sustained from -20 to 70°C.
System Architecture
- 1. Passenger Validation Workflow:
- A commuter presents a contactless smart card or scans a QR code at the gate.
- The MS-C906 processes the data, checks its validity against the central ticketing system, and sends a command to open or deny the gate.
- 2. Centralized Monitoring:
- Real-time data from all gates is transmitted to the control room via the high-speed LAN interface.
- Gate performance, passenger flow statistics, and fault diagnostics are monitored centrally.
